The great debate over two of the great conversions. Will give people context for those who don’t know what I’m talking about or remember.

1) 1998 semi To make the gf was dogs vs parra. Dogs were getting thrashed 18-2 with 10 remaining. They came back With 3 tries and willie Talau scores with two minutes to go in corner. Score was 18-16 and halligan had to make the kick to send it to extra time.

2) dogs vs knights in 02. Knights up 21-16 dogs scored in corner and el Masri down 21-20 had to make gk to win and he did.
